Vatican UN Envoy Stresses Importance of Religious Freedom
NEW YORK (CWNews.com) -- Archbishop Renato Martino reminded the United Nations of the importance of religious freedom, as the international body discussed basic human rights. "The Holy See is particularly concerned by the fact that in many parts of the world, discriminatory or intolerant laws are applied, particularly against minority groups in states that have an official religion," the Vatican envoy said. He argued that "the right to life, the right to freedom of religion or belief, and respect for religions and cultural heritage are basic needs of human life."
